Does anyone deal with crushing loneliness? It feels so heavy when your friends and family are busy and you want to talk. What do you all do to ease this pain?

Top reply
    • Pisforpotato

      618d

      I personally enjoy reading because I like to imagine me myself in the story line and submerging myself in it. Sometimes you can kind of lose touch with reality that way and the loneliness doesn’t feel so crushing. I also like guided meditations that allow me to imagine myself in other worlds, so kind of the same thing. I just literally take myself out of this world and place myself into another one. Works for me🤷🏼‍♀️

    • SweetandSourMama

      621d

      I get this a lot. The only remedy I have found is for me to reach out to a friend or family member and let them know how I'm feeling. I have to force myself though, I have horrific social anxiety. It's really a wonder that I have anyone to reach out to. Other times I have reached out to a community on social media. My art group or my mental health groups. Sometimes just posting "hey guys, crushing loneliness tonight. Anyone care to chat?" Will get a few responses. Unfortunately this tends to happen to me late at night when I've had a few drinks and can't sleep, but everyone else can. In this case I usually try to read a book, leave a few sweet messages for my tribe to respond to in the morning... Or people on social media are more likely to be up. Hope that helps! It's really, really hard for me to do, but I always feel better later.
